Adapting a home around a specific accessibility need is a different exercise from a general accessibility upgrade — it starts with the individual's actual movement, equipment and daily routine, not a standard list of features.
Understanding what's typically involved, and who else needs to be part of the conversation, helps set realistic expectations before work is scoped.
Starting with the person, not the room
A generic accessible bathroom or bedroom specification can miss the actual requirement entirely if it isn't built around how this specific person moves, transfers, and uses equipment day to day. What works for one wheelchair user may not suit another, depending on transfer method, equipment used and the level of assistance involved.
Involving the person the adaptation is for, wherever possible, in walking through the proposed layout before it's finalised catches mismatches that a plan drawing alone won't reveal.
Working with occupational therapy advice
Many accessibility adaptations are informed by an occupational therapist's assessment, sometimes linked to funding through a Disabled Facilities Grant or similar scheme. Where this applies, the OT's specified requirements — turning circles, transfer space, equipment clearances — need to be built into the design from the start, not adjusted around a design already drawn up.
Coordinating directly between the OT and whoever is doing the construction avoids a plan that looks right on paper but doesn't actually meet the assessed need once built.
Structural work for level access and widened openings
Structural changes for accessibility are more common than people expect, because standard door and corridor widths in most existing housing stock are narrower than modern accessible equipment needs. This should be identified and costed early, not discovered once other finishes are already specified.
- Removing internal walls or door frames to widen openings for wheelchair or equipment access
- Altering floor levels or thresholds to remove steps
- Strengthening floor structure where hoists or heavy equipment will be installed
- Reinforcing walls for fixed lifting equipment or robust grab rail loading
Durability under different use patterns
Fittings and surfaces in an adapted room often take different, sometimes heavier, wear than in a standard household — equipment contact, repeated hoist use, wheelchair footrests against skirtings. Specifying for this actual use pattern, rather than standard domestic durability, avoids early failure of finishes and fittings.
This is a conversation worth having explicitly with your trade, since standard product ranges aren't always rated for this kind of contact.
Discreet, not institutional, finishes
There's a wide range of accessible fittings — grab rails, wet room floors, height-adjustable elements — available in finishes that don't look clinical, and choosing among them is entirely reasonable alongside meeting the functional requirement.
Raising this preference at specification stage, rather than assuming function and appearance are in conflict, gets a better result for a room the family will live with daily.
Common questions
Do we need an occupational therapist involved before starting work?+
Not always, but where funding through a grant scheme is involved, or the needs are complex, an OT assessment usually forms the basis of the design and should be coordinated with the construction plan from the outset.
Will structural work always be needed?+
Often, because standard door and corridor widths in existing housing are usually narrower than accessible equipment requires. This should be assessed early rather than assumed unnecessary.
Can adapted fittings look like a normal, non-clinical room?+
Yes — a wide range of accessible products are available in finishes that don't read as institutional, and this is worth specifying for explicitly alongside the functional brief.
